	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;"> David Pastor &amp; Latino Blanco - The cool session</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	 
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;">David Pastor, trumpet</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	 
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;">Latino Blanco, baritone saxophone</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	 
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;">Miquel Álvarez, double bass</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	 
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;">Miquel Asensio, drums</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;">Valencia is a land of musicians. And yesterday at Jimmy's, two of the most charismatic musicians—not just in the UK, but in the world—came together. Although it all started in Africa, it developed in the USA and from there it was better marketed worldwide. Here, if we knew how to promote it half as well as they did, these two would be world jazz stars.</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;"> I'm talking about baritone saxophonist, composer, producer and educator Francisco "Latino" Blanco and trumpeter and composer David Pastor.</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;"> Last night at that jazz mecca called Jimmy Glass, they offered us a concert of good old-fashioned jazz, which delighted everyone present.</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;"> Accompanied by a rhythm section of two musicians also from the area, namely the double bassist Miquel Álvarez and the drummer Miquel Asensio, we were able to witness a tribute to the cool jazz of the east coast, with hints of bop and all the talent of the aforementioned musicians.</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;"> Themes mainly by Gerry Mulligan, the great reference of Latino where the constant dialogue saxophone - trumpet, each in its moment and perfectly balanced, elevated the music of this genius even more.</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;"> Needless to say, the rhythm section shone brilliantly, with Álvarez's precision on the double bass and his pleasant scats, as well as the precision and forcefulness, beautiful and well-measured drumming of Asensio.</font></font>
</p>

<p style="color:#000000;font-size:medium;text-align:left;">
	<font style="vertical-align:inherit;"><font style="vertical-align:inherit;"> A great night of jazz, which left a very good taste in the mouths of all those present on this night before Palm Sunday, the beginning of a Holy week.</font></font>
